International Standards in the Packaging Machinery Industry

The packaging machinery industry is subject to a variety of standards, which can be both national and international. For bubble paper machines, some relevant international standards exist, although they may not be as comprehensive as one might expect.

bubble-machine03-2-600x600bubble-machine04-1-600x600

One of the most well - known international standard - setting organizations is the International Organization for Standardization (ISO). ISO develops and publishes standards that cover a wide range of industries, including packaging machinery. While there isn't a specific ISO standard dedicated solely to bubble paper machines, ISO standards related to general packaging machinery can have an impact.

For example, ISO 12100 provides general principles for the design of machinery to ensure safety. This standard is applicable to bubble paper machines as it addresses aspects such as risk assessment, safety requirements for machinery components, and the design of control systems. Adhering to ISO 12100 helps manufacturers produce machines that are safe for operators to use, reducing the risk of accidents in the workplace.

Another important aspect is the electrical safety of the machines. The International Electrotechnical Commission (IEC) sets standards for electrical equipment. Bubble paper machines, which often have complex electrical systems for heating, extrusion, and control, must comply with IEC standards such as IEC 60204 - 1. This standard ensures that the electrical parts of the machine are designed and installed in a way that minimizes the risk of electrical shock and fire hazards.

Regional and National Standards

In addition to international standards, regional and national standards also play a crucial role. In the European Union, the Machinery Directive 2006/42/EC is a key regulation for all types of machinery, including bubble paper machines. This directive sets out essential health and safety requirements for machinery placed on the EU market. Machines must be CE marked, indicating compliance with the directive, before they can be sold in the EU.

In the United States, the Occupational Safety and Health Administration (OSHA) has regulations related to workplace safety, which indirectly affect bubble paper machine manufacturers. For example, OSHA requires employers to provide a safe working environment, and machine manufacturers need to ensure that their products meet safety standards to help employers comply with these regulations.

In Asia, countries like China and Japan have their own national standards for packaging machinery. Chinese standards, such as GB standards, are designed to ensure the quality and safety of machinery produced and used in the country. Japanese standards also focus on aspects like safety, performance, and energy efficiency.

Challenges in Complying with Multiple Standards

However, complying with multiple standards can be a challenge. Different countries and regions may have slightly different requirements, and keeping up with all these changes can be time - consuming and costly. For instance, the testing and certification processes for different standards can vary significantly. Some standards may require extensive laboratory testing, while others may involve on - site inspections.

As a supplier, we need to invest in resources to ensure that our machines meet all the necessary standards. This includes hiring experts in standard compliance, conducting regular internal audits, and maintaining detailed documentation of the manufacturing process.
